How to Pick the Right Stocks for Beginners


Image

Stepping into the stock market can feel overwhelming, especially when you’re faced with hundreds of companies to choose from. But don’t worry; picking the right stocks isn’t about luck or complicated strategies. Successful investing begins with a simple and disciplined approach.

1. Start with What You Understand


Focus first on businesses you understand and use in your everyday life. Understanding how a company earns money helps you make more informed decisions. Avoid investing in businesses that you find difficult to understand. A 2023 investor study showed that first-time investors are more likely to stay invested longer when they choose companies they understand.

2. Check the Financial Health


After selecting potential stocks, review their key financial indicators. Even if you’re new to finance, you can focus on simple metrics.

? Does the business show consistent profitability?
? Is the company showing steady sales growth year after year?
? Is the company’s debt at a reasonable level?

These signals indicate strong financial health and future growth potential.

4. Focus on Long-Term Growth


Don’t fall for short-term hype or viral stock picks. Long-term investing not only reduces your risk but also gives your money time to grow. Studies reveal that long-term investors consistently outperform active traders.

5. Spread Out Your Investments


Try not to put all your money into just one company or one type of business; spreading it out helps you stay safer if something doesn’t go as planned. Invest across various industries and sectors for better safety. This spreads out the risk and helps maintain balance if one sector underperforms.

For beginners, simplicity and consistency are the best investment tools. Get to know what the company does, keep an eye on the simple stuff, and be patient—good things take time. With experience, both your knowledge and wealth will increase.
